簡體   English   中英

如何將存儲在 azure devOps 存儲庫中的 json 文件作為 blob 復制到 azure 存儲帳戶?

[英]How to copy .json file stored in azure devOps repo to azure storage account as a blob?

有一個文件存儲在 azure devOps 的存儲庫中。 我想每天將該文件傳輸到 azure 存儲帳戶。 有什么辦法,我們可以做到嗎?

假設文件名是 Hack.json 並存儲在 github 存儲庫中的路徑上:Azure-Models/samples/src/Hack.json 並且我們希望將其存儲在具有樣本名稱的存儲帳戶容器中。

您可以使用帶有已定義 cronAzureFileCopy 任務的計划的管道

schedules:
- cron: "0 0 * * *"
  displayName: Daily midnight build
  branches:
    include:
    - main
  always: true

trigger: none
pr: none

steps:
# Azure file copy
# Copy files to Azure Blob Storage or virtual machines
- task: AzureFileCopy@4
  inputs:
    sourcePath: 
    azureSubscription: 
    destination: # Options: azureBlob, azureVMs
    storage: 
    #containerName: # Required when destination == AzureBlob
    #blobPrefix: # Optional
    #resourceGroup: # Required when destination == AzureVMs
    #resourceFilteringMethod: 'machineNames' # Optional. Options: machineNames, tags
    #machineNames: # Optional
    #vmsAdminUserName: # Required when destination == AzureVMs
    #vmsAdminPassword: # Required when destination == AzureVMs
    #targetPath: # Required when destination == AzureVMs
    #additionalArgumentsForBlobCopy: # Optional
    #additionalArgumentsForVMCopy: # Optional
    #enableCopyPrerequisites: false # Optional
    #copyFilesInParallel: true # Optional
    #cleanTargetBeforeCopy: false # Optional
    #skipCACheck: true # Optional
    #sasTokenTimeOutInMinutes: # Optional

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M